description | The Velo tracking algorithm was developed based on the idea described in the TP for Level-1 trigger, namely to start by a triplet of consecutive stations. During the recent LHCC review, this was pointed out as being quite sensitive to detector inefficiencies, for example dead strips, which were not in the simulation. Since then, I have implemented a small modification to the Velo tracking algorithm, which reduces to an acceptable level the sensitivity to detector inefficiencies. This short note describes the original situation, the changes and the new performance, with some comments on possible future improvements. |
